The process of appropriately securing threaded connections in gas systems to ensure a leak-proof seal is critical for safety and functionality. Over-tightening can damage the threads or the fitting itself, while under-tightening results in a potential gas leak. Achieving the correct level of tightness is essential for reliable performance. For example, using pipe dope or Teflon tape correctly and then applying the proper amount of torque ensures a secure and safe joint.

Properly sealed gas fittings are vital for preventing gas leaks, which can lead to explosions, fires, and health hazards. This process has been a concern since the inception of piped gas systems, with standards and practices evolving over time to enhance safety and efficiency. Adhering to recommended torque specifications and employing appropriate sealing techniques contribute to system longevity, reduced maintenance costs, and the overall safety of property and individuals.
